As heard in the ending credits of Wolfenstein: The Old Blood.
Developed by MachineGames and published by Bethesda/Zenimax.
Vocals: Tex Perkins
Strings: Pete Whitfield, Simon Turner, Nick Trygstad, Alex Stemp, Paulette Bayley
Everything else: Mick Gordon
________________________________________
“Song of the French Partisan”
Performed by Tex Perkins & Mick Gordon
Written by Emmanuel d’Astier, English Adaptation by Hy Zaret
Composed by Anna Marly
Published by Additions Raoul Breton
Arranged by Mick Gordon
Produced and Mixed by Mick Gordon
Recorded at Sing Sing Studios, Melbourne, Australia

This seems to be a translation of a French resistance song called La Complainte du Partisan, with some bits of the Chant des Partisans mixed in together. And all of it modernised and more punchy... This has a strong meaning to me as a Frenchman, my great-grandfather had been arrested and deported by the Wehrmacht for various acts of sabotage, and my great-grandparents on the other side of the family had been saved from arrest by a couple of German bakers... A strong song if it manages to evoke all of this to me, outstanding job, Mr Gordon, thank you very much.

For a musician it's quite hard to keep the musical harmony and the coherence with the video game scenario at the same time. But starting with "Adrift" in the New Order, until the end of "The Partisan", a musical adventure goes on side by side with the adventure in the game. Two games tell us a story, a very same story which is written by Emmanuel d'Astier de la Vigerie in 1943. From the very beginning of the first game (the New Order) the music is also telling us the same story. Injecting this feeling to the heart of a video game player is very hard job to achieve for a musician. Thank you for all those precious time of yours that you spent while composing these beautiful soundtrack albums. On the other hand "The Partisan" is the ending point of two games; the last stop in the musical adventure (and I'm not saying that because the credits are shown in the game at the same time). I can easily connect the musical atmosphere in Adrift and this song. The Partisan is one of the best game songs I ever listened. Musically, I didn't like the sound of distortion in fact, but it completely fits in the game; so I can say nothing about that. The acoustic guitar intro of the song starts the depression by itself and in the end strings maximize that feeling. I loved the string arrangements and the vocals of Tex Perkins which are full of emotion. Also I must say that, even though this version is completely different from Leonard Cohen version of the song, I still get the same impression from both songs; same feeling, same dark and depressed war atmosphere and more importantly, same requiem.
